Merrymeeting Waterfowl Museum: A Hidden Gem in Brunswick, United States
The Merrymeeting Waterfowl Museum is a unique destination located in Brunswick, Maine. This charming museum is dedicated to the appreciation and conservation of waterfowl, particularly in the context of Maine’s rich natural heritage. Nestled near Merrymeeting Bay, the museum serves not only as an educational resource but also as a celebration of the diverse range of waterfowl species in the region.

Attractions and Collections
The museum features a diverse collection of exhibits that showcase various aspects of waterfowl and their habitats. Visitors can expect to find intricately carved duck decoys, informative displays on different waterfowl species, and photographs that capture the beauty of these birds in their natural settings. Each exhibit provides valuable information, allowing guests to learn more about the specific species and their roles in the ecosystem.
